Transaction 322a51ec9273dfd94ab2241a343b9e7f0332163e5ea848fb12f4cc764059abae
1 Input
1 Output
-
322a51ec9273dfd94ab2241a343b9e7f0332163e5ea848fb12f4cc764059abae:0
- value
- 772332
- script pubkey
- OP_0 OP_PUSHBYTES_20 e186bb095660d217f28a99fdc2f551eeba3a4c5f
- address
- bc1quxrtkz2kvrfp0u52n87u9a23a6ar5nzlyv4a7y